2. Conversation of Your Case:
You will certainly have the possibility to supply your lawyer with a comprehensive account of the events leading up to your apprehension or charges. It is necessary to be truthful and open, as this info will certainly help your lawyer assess the toughness and weaknesses of your situation. They may ask you specific inquiries to gather more info and make clear any details.

4. Defense Approaches and Lawful Choices:
Based upon the details you offer and the evidence assessed, your lawyer will certainly review prospective protection approaches and legal alternatives. They will explain the strengths and weaknesses of each method and aid you understand the potential results. This is a possibility for you to ask concerns and gain a clear understanding of your defense strategy moving on.

5. Fee Framework and Lawful Costs:
Your lawyer will certainly discuss their fee structure and any connected legal prices during the preliminary consultation. This is a vital discussion to have in advance to guarantee you recognize the economic ramifications of working with legal representation. They might likewise review payment plans or choices for financing legal fees.

6. Privacy and Attorney-Client Privilege:
Your lawyer will stress the importance of confidentiality and attorney-client privilege. They will clarify that anything you go over throughout the assessment is protected by legislation and will certainly not be shown to any person without your approval. This is critical for establishing count on and ensuring open communication throughout your situation.

7. Following Steps:
At the end of the assessment, your lawyer will lay out the next action in the legal process. This might include collecting additional proof, submitting movements, discussing with the prosecution, or preparing for test. They will provide you with a clear timeline and keep you educated concerning any crucial advancements in your situation.

Exploring Defense Techniques and Lawful Options



As soon as all the necessary info has been collected and talked about, it's time to explore the world of protection methods and discover the different lawful alternatives available to you. Your criminal defense lawyer will certainly lead you through this vital action, making sure that you understand the potential courses your instance could take. Below are 3 vital elements to think about during this process:

- ** Crafting a solid protection: ** Your lawyer will very carefully evaluate the proof against you and develop a defense method tailored to your certain scenarios. They will check out every possible angle to challenge the prosecution's instance and secure your rights.


- ** Discussing plea bargains: ** Depending on the conditions, your attorney might discover the option of bargaining an appeal bargain with the prosecution. This can potentially cause lowered fees or charges, providing a favorable end result for you.

- ** Discovering alternative resolutions: ** Your attorney will certainly likewise explore different resolutions, such as diversion programs or recovery alternatives, if they think it might be beneficial to your instance. These alternatives can supply a chance at rehab as opposed to imprisonment.

Remember, your criminal defense attorney is your advocate and will certainly function tirelessly to safeguard your rights and passions throughout the legal process.
